  19. I thought Macca's set was excellent. I don't get this "should have retired gracefully" stuff, age is just a number in music. I remember an interview with Elvis Costello when he turned 50 and he was asked how much longer he could go on. He said "It's only rock and roll that has an obsession with age, if I was a jazz musician they would be saying, that kid Costello shows promise, he might really do something when he's older" The fact that both he and McCartney are still bringing out new material, when other performers of their age and younger are just trotting out their hits at Butlins, should be celebrated not chastised. Having said that, the Glastonbury audience is a different animal so I do think the set should have reflected the fact the majority will not be following his new output.
